Registered Manager – Children's Residential Home Derby
Full Time | 37.5 hours
£51,500 – £53,000 per annum
£7,500 Welcome Bonus
Diamond Search Recruitment is recruiting on behalf of a leading children's residential care provider for an experienced Registered Manager in Derby. This is an excellent opportunity to lead a warm, nurturing children's home and make a genuine difference to the lives of young people.
The Role
- Lead and manage a children's residential home
- Ensure compliance with Children's Homes Regulations and safeguarding standards
- Deliver high-quality, child-centred care
- Lead, motivate, and develop a committed staff team
- Manage budgets, resources, and day-to-day operations
- Work closely with professionals to achieve positive outcomes
About You
- Proven experience as a Registered Manager within children's residential care
- Strong understanding of legislation, safeguarding, and Ofsted standards
- Excellent leadership and communication skills
- Level 3 Diploma in Children & Young People's Workforce
- Level 5 Diploma in Leadership & Management (or willingness to work towards)
- Full UK driving licence
